The article discusses the major principles of innovation processes effective management. In the article there are defined the main participants of innovation process and functions of innovation process management. There is given a general diagram of innovation process management. Also there is stated that effective management of innovation processes is closely connected with combination of all the system elements in a company activity. Creation and wide distribution of new products and services becomes a determining factor of a company growth and development, increase of production, employment rate and of investments attraction. Innovative development is the most important factor capable of increasing company competitiveness. This factor is based on various kinds of activity such as scientific, social, production or financial activity. Innovations are aimed at significant increase of technical and economic efficiency of company activity.
